Transaction bf148e98f594085166727120feffe3ddf9727a9ec295077e4c20a778248ee818
1 Input
1 Output
-
bf148e98f594085166727120feffe3ddf9727a9ec295077e4c20a778248ee818:0
- value
- 43172160
- script pubkey
- OP_0 OP_PUSHBYTES_20 899c92b4a4f57e188c2200449e3a34bea7d81db5
- address
- bc1q3xwf9d9y74lp3rpzqpzfuw35h6nas8d4wfms8a